About this experience
Shun the tourist trail for two of the Angkor empire’s less-visited gems on this small-group tour. Your certified guide will show you around Beng Mealea, a vast ruined temple complex that’s still covered in jungle in places, and Koh Ker, the 10th-century imperial capital. Your tour includes hotel transfers, iced water, and cold towels.

Koh Ker Temple
Koh Ker is a remote archaeological site in northern Cambodia about 120 kilometres (75 mi) away from Siem Reap and the ancient site of Angkor.

Prasat Beng Mealea
Beng Mealea or Boeng Mealea, is a temple from the Angkor Wat period : 118–119 located 40 km (25 mi) east of the main group of temples at Angkor.
